Payload Systems Engineering Manager - Permanent - UK

Apply
  • Job Location: Bristol, England
  • Type: Permanent
  • Posted: 09/02/2021

The Payload System Engineering Manager will have the following responsibilities:

• Manage customer mission/system requirements and devolve these into subsystem requirements
• Lead the technical activities and coordinate the team
• Manage the compliance of the solution to customer requirement with the design authority
• Coordinate and lead internal and external design review (PDR, CDR, TRR, FAR) with all parties including customer, project management, quality management
• Manage interfaces between subsystems
• Critically review inputs from the different teams (systems, electronics,mechanical/thermal)
• Support the verification strategy for the end to end system validation
• Propose system development strategy (EM, EQM. PFM) to mitigate schedule risks and budget constraint
• Liaise with customers and subcontractors on technical issues
• Mentoring of team members
• Support further bids providing technical insight as well as costing inputs
• Manage costs and schedule for system work packages


Capital International Staffing Ltd is acting as an Employment Business in relation to this vacancy.

Apply

Back to job listings

View all jobs